START UPDATE

The START UPDATE command starts all updater processes on the backup system.
START UPDATE

Where Issued

Primary system only.

Security Restrictions

You can issue the START UPDATE command if you are a member of the super-user group and
have a remote password from the RDF primary system to the backup.

RDF State Requirement

Before you can issue this command, RDF must be running.

Usage Guidelines

After the updater processes start, they examine the audit data in the RDF image files and apply
any changes to the backup database.

Example

To initiate updating on the backup system of all volumes protected by RDF, enter:
]START UPDATE

STATUS

The STATUS command displays current configuration information and operational statistics for
the RDF environment, or specified portions thereof. All forms of the STATUS command, except
STATUS RTDWARNING, automatically include information and statistics for the monitor
process.
